Engineered Siding Installation Questions
What is engineered siding? Engineered siding is a manufactured material designed to mimic traditional wood siding, offering enhanced durability and resistance to pests and weather.
What types of properties benefit from engineered siding? Residential homes, commercial buildings, and historic properties can all benefit from the durability and low maintenance of engineered siding.
How is engineered siding installed? Installation involves attaching the panels securely to the exterior wall framework, often with specialized fasteners, to ensure a weather-tight and long-lasting finish.
What should property owners consider before choosing engineered siding? It's important to evaluate the siding's compatibility with existing exterior surfaces, desired aesthetic, and maintenance requirements to ensure a suitable choice.
